“What I’ve learned over the years is that what really makes you look good is if you’re curious and happy,” says Fonda, who’s calling from the 2023 Cannes Film Festival. “If you’re interested and happy, that shows in your face.” She says that these days, when she looks back at photos of her that were taken during not-so-happy times in her life, she can immediately see that reflected in the way she looked. “Often it would mean I was wearing too much makeup.” These days, Fonda is much more concerned with caring for her skin than she is with piling on makeup. It’s also why she’s the face of L’Oréal’s Age Perfect Rosy Tone Skincare line. Fonda has been working with the brand for 15 years, something that she says continues to amaze her. “I’m still working for L’Oréal, at my age. I have to pinch myself sometimes.”

Speaking of pinching (stay with me for a second), Fonda shares that she only began paying attention to her looks after starring alongside Katharine Hepburn in 1981’s On Golden Pond. “She made it very clear to me that she did not like the fact that I didn’t pay much attention to how I looked. She came up behind me one day and took my cheek between her fingers and said, ‘This is what you present to the world.’ She wanted me to be more self-aware about how I presented myself. And I think I’ve followed her advice and I do pay more attention now. It’s why I let my hair go grey, to match my face. Not because my face is grey,”…
